Consumers have flagged Firstoptionskyrockets.com, citing it as an operation involved in an investment con. They entice you with promises of impressive returns on your investment. However, once you invest, the money vanishes as the fraudsters make a quick exit. The site is riddled with underdeveloped pages brimming with untouched content and placeholder text. The images they’ve used are inauthentic. Furthermore, the website falsely asserts various partnerships. On inspection, we noticed the website’s content lacks originality and instead, appears to imitate other similar platforms. Strangely, there’s a noticeable absence of any reviews for the company.

Investment scams typically involve enticing potential investors with promises of high returns with little to no risk. However, once the investor hands over their money, the scammer often disappears without a trace. The investor is left with no returns and a significant loss. Such scams can take various forms and often involve complex schemes or fraudulent investment opportunities.

An investment scam is a fraudulent scheme to trick people into investing their money. The scammer promises high returns with little to no risk. They make it sound like a sure thing. But in reality, the money is not being invested at all. Instead, the scammer uses the money for their own purposes. They might spend it on luxury items or use it to pay off old investors. This is known as a Ponzi scheme. The scam continues until the scammer runs out of new investors. At that point, they disappear with the money, leaving the investors with nothing. Investment scams can take many forms. They might involve stocks, real estate, or even cryptocurrencies. The common thread is the promise of easy money. But as the old saying goes, if it sounds too good to be true, it probably is. Always do your research before investing and be wary of anyone who promises guaranteed returns.
